Module #1 Introduction to Rituals and Belief Systems Overview of the course, exploring the significance of rituals and belief systems in shaping human culture and identity.
Module #2 Defining Rituals and Belief Systems Examining the concepts of rituals and belief systems, including their components, functions, and variations across cultures.
Module #3 Theories of Rituals and Belief Systems Exploring major theoretical frameworks for understanding rituals and belief systems, including anthropological, sociological, and psychological perspectives.
Module #4 Rituals of Birth and Coming of Age Comparing rituals surrounding birth and coming of age across cultures, including initiation rites, naming ceremonies, and puberty rituals.
Module #5 Rituals of Marriage and Partnership Examining the diverse rituals and customs surrounding marriage and partnership, including wedding ceremonies, betrothals, and divorce rituals.
Module #6 Rituals of Death and Mourning Exploring the various rituals and beliefs surrounding death and mourning, including funeral rites, ancestor worship, and mourning practices.
Module #7 Rituals of Healing and Medicine Investigating the role of ritual in healing practices, including shamanism, faith healing, and traditional medicine.
Module #8 Rituals of Food and Eating Comparing the cultural significance of food and eating rituals, including communal meals, taboos, and sacred foods.
Module #9 Rituals of Community and Social Bonding Examining the role of ritual in fostering community and social bonds, including festivals, pilgrimages, and communal rituals.
Module #10 Rituals of Spirituality and Mysticism Exploring the diverse beliefs and practices of spiritual and mystical traditions, including meditation, prayer, and mysticism.
Module #11 Rituals of Ancestor Veneration Investigating the significance of ancestor worship across cultures, including rituals, offerings, and ancestral spirits.
Module #12 Rituals of Nature and the Environment Examining the cultural significance of nature and environmental rituals, including harvest festivals, solstice celebrations, and eco-spirituality.
Module #13 Rituals of Identity and Belonging Exploring the role of ritual in shaping individual and group identity, including initiation rites, cultural festivals, and identity performances.
Module #14 Rituals of Conflict and War Investigating the relationship between ritual and conflict, including war rituals, memorial rites, and reconciliation ceremonies.
Module #15 Rituals of Power and Authority Examining the role of ritual in maintaining and challenging power structures, including coronation ceremonies, royal rituals, and resistance movements.
Module #16 Rituals of Globalization and Modernity Exploring the impact of globalization on traditional rituals and belief systems, including cultural fusion, hybridity, and neo-traditionalism.
Module #17 Rituals of Secularity and Non-Belief Investigating the rise of secularism and non-belief, including secular rituals, humanist ceremonies, and post-religious identities.
Module #18 Rituals of Technology and Digital Culture Examining the role of technology in shaping new rituals and belief systems, including online spirituality, digital shrines, and cyber-rituals.
Module #19 Rituals of Social Justice and Activism Exploring the relationship between ritual and social justice, including protest rituals, activist movements, and ritually-driven social change.
Module #20 Rituals of Memory and Heritage Investigating the role of ritual in preserving cultural heritage, including commemoration rituals, museum exhibitions, and cultural revival movements.
Module #21 Rituals of Performance and Entertainment Examining the intersection of ritual and performance, including ritualized theatre, dance, and music performances.
Module #22 Rituals of Sport and Competition Investigating the ritualistic aspects of sports and competition, including pre-game rituals, victory ceremonies, and sports mythology.
Module #23 Rituals of Place and Space Exploring the cultural significance of ritualized spaces, including sacred architecture, pilgrimage sites, and ritual landscapes.
